Are these casinos legal for Aussies?
Yes, but with a catch. The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 makes it illegal for offshore operators to offer real-money gambling to Australians. However, many crypto casinos are based in Curacao and operate in a gray area. You are not breaking the law by playing. The risk is the operator shutting down or refusing to pay. That is why you pick a reputable one.
What wagering requirements should I accept?
35x is standard. 40x is a bit high. 50x is predatory. Do not accept bonuses with wagering over 45x unless you are prepared to grind for hours. Also, check the max bet rule. Many sites cap your bet at 5 AUD while wagering.
Do I need to verify my ID (KYC)?
Yes, eventually. Even crypto casinos require KYC for withdrawals over a certain threshold (often 1 BTC or equivalent). Some “no KYC” sites exist, but they are extremely risky. I prefer a site that asks for verification upfront. It means they are compliant and less likely to run off with your money.
